TS3A5017RSVR Information
TS3A5017RSVR by Texas Instruments is a Multiplexer or Switch.
Multiplexers or Switches are under the broader part category of Signal Circuits.
A signal is an electronic means of transmitting information, either as an analog signal with continuous values or a digital signal with discrete values. Signals are used in various systems and networks. Read more about Signal Circuits on our Signal Circuits part category page.

Compare Parts:
TS3A5017RSVR
Texas Instruments
3.3-V, 4:1, 2-channel general-purpose analog multiplexer 16-UQFN -40 to 85
|
Pbfree Code | Yes | |
Rohs Code | Yes | |
Part Life Cycle Code | Active | |
Ihs Manufacturer | TEXAS INSTRUMENTS INC | |
Part Package Code | QFN | |
Pin Count | 16 | |
Reach Compliance Code | compliant | |
ECCN Code | EAR99 | |
HTS Code | 8542.39.00.01 | |
Samacsys Manufacturer | Texas Instruments | |
Analog IC - Other Type | SINGLE-ENDED MULTIPLEXER | |
Bandwidth-Nom | 165 MHz | |
JESD-30 Code | R-PQCC-N16 | |
JESD-609 Code | e4 | |
Length | 2.6 mm | |
Moisture Sensitivity Level | 1 | |
Normal Position | NC | |
Number of Channels | 2 | |
Number of Functions | 2 | |
Number of Terminals | 16 | |
Off-state Isolation-Nom | 48 dB | |
On-state Resistance Match-Nom | 1 Ω | |
On-state Resistance-Max (Ron) | 24 Ω | |
Operating Temperature-Max | 85 °C | |
Operating Temperature-Min | -40 °C | |
Output | COMMON OUTPUT | |
Package Body Material | PLASTIC/EPOXY | |
Package Code | VQCCN | |
Package Equivalence Code | LCC16,.07X.1,16 | |
Package Shape | RECTANGULAR | |
Package Style | CHIP CARRIER, VERY THIN PROFILE | |
Peak Reflow Temperature (Cel) | 260 | |
Qualification Status | Not Qualified | |
Seated Height-Max | 0.55 mm | |
Signal Current-Max | 0.1 A | |
Supply Current-Max (Isup) | 0.01 mA | |
Supply Voltage-Max (Vsup) | 3.6 V | |
Supply Voltage-Min (Vsup) | 2.3 V | |
Supply Voltage-Nom (Vsup) | 2.5 V | |
Surface Mount | YES | |
Switch-off Time-Max | 6 ns | |
Switch-on Time-Max | 10 ns | |
Switching | BREAK-BEFORE-MAKE | |
Temperature Grade | INDUSTRIAL | |
Terminal Finish | Nickel/Palladium/Gold (Ni/Pd/Au) | |
Terminal Form | NO LEAD | |
Terminal Pitch | 0.4 mm | |
Terminal Position | QUAD | |
Time@Peak Reflow Temperature-Max (s) | 30 | |
Width | 1.8 mm |
